The UK's Office of Gas and Electricity Markets (OFGEM) will allow electricity generators using waste-derived fuels to use the Carbon-14 technique to determine the renewable energy content of the fuel. Under this method, post-combustion flue gases will be analyzed for their carbon-14 content and not the solid waste feedstock. Read More

In the consultation document published by the UK Department for Transport (DfT) regarding the implementation of the transport elements of the EU Renewable Energy Directive, the DfT is proposing to determine the renewable portion of partially renewable fuels through carbon-14 dating techniques.
